Introduction
We created the CTU APA Writing Style Guide as a tool to help students understand and
apply the University’s citation method and writing expectations. CTU has adopted the American
Psychological Association (APA) citation style for all classes, graduate and undergraduate. APA
establishes a citation system that includes a set of rules and guidelines for manuscript preparation
and documentation of sources. When writing assignments of any type, you must document and
cite all sources properly using APA style. Citing and referencing sources correctly both
indicates your professional ability to include other voices in your work and prevents accusations
of plagiarism.
Our CTU APA Writing Style Guide answers some of the common questions CTU students
ask about using APA style for formatting documents, including in-text citations and constructing
references. However, if you have questions not answered in our guide, please consult either the
APA Style for CTU Students or The Publication Manual of the American Psychological
Association, 6th ed. (2010).
Along with our guide, use the APA Paper Template when composing essays or other
papers. This Microsoft Word document is already formatted for APA style using the
expectations outlined in our guide.
Refer to the Introductory APA Writing Style Guide if your assignment advises its use. The
introductory style guide emphasizes proper citation of sources and basic formatting but does not
require more advanced formatting, including title page, abstract, running head, or page numbers.

Abstract
An abstract is a single paragraph, without indentation, that summarizes the key points of the manuscript in 150 to 250 words. The purpose of the abstract is to provide the reader with a brief overview of the paper. This template is based on 6thed of the Publication manual of the American Psychological Association.
Note: an abstract is only required if the assignment calls for it. Consult with your instructor.
